Форум: "Основная";
Текущий архив: 2005.07.11;
Скачать: [xml.tar.bz2];
ВнизФорма на самом верху Найти похожие ветки
← →
alexa (2005-06-21 12:52) [0]Как вывести одну из форм поверх всех приложений, которые в данный момент загружены?
← →
TUser © (2005-06-21 13:03) [1]fsStayOnTop
← →
alexa (2005-06-21 13:12) [2]
> fsStayOnTop
А что это вообще такое и куда это писать надо?
← →
alexa (2005-06-21 13:38) [3]Помогите, мне очень нужно
← →
TUser © (2005-06-21 13:41) [4]FormStyle:=fsStayOnTop;
← →
Eraser © (2005-06-21 14:48) [5]alexa (21.06.05 12:52)
private
{ Private declarations }
procedure CreateParams(var Params: TCreateParams); override;
...
procedure TfmVoiceStatus.CreateParams(var Params: TCreateParams);
begin
inherited CreateParams(Params);
Params.WndParent := GetDesktopWindow;
Params.ExStyle := Params.ExStyle and not WS_EX_APPWINDOW or WS_EX_TOOLWINDOW;
end;
procedure TfmVoiceStatus.FormCreate(Sender: TObject);
var
dwStyle: integer;
begin
dwStyle := GetWindowLong(self.Handle, GWL_EXSTYLE);
SetWindowLong(self.Handle, GWL_EXSTYLE, dwStyle or WS_EX_TOPMOST);
end;
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2005.07.11;
Скачать: [xml.tar.bz2];
Память: 0.45 MB
Время: 0.037 c